Ethereum L1 Skaling Roadmap: Vitalik Buterin's suggestions for increasing performance

Vitalik Buterin, co-founder of Ethereum, has proposed a comprehensive roadmap for scaling Ethereum on Layer-1 (L1). The aim of this initiative is to significantly increase the performance of the network, while at the same time implemented innovative solutions for data management. The focus is on the Ethereum Improvement Proposal (EIP) 4444 and distributed memory solutions.

EIP-4444 aims to optimize the efficiency of the Ethereum network by improved management of the blockchain data. In a constantly developing blockchain environment, the possibility of increasing performance without affecting safety or decentralization aspects is of crucial importance. By implementing these proposals, Ethereum could not only be faster, but also better equipped to meet future requirements.

A central aspect of Buterin's suggestions is the implementation of distributed storage solutions. These technologies could enable data to store and process data more efficiently, which would further improve the total performance of the network. In combination with EIP-4444, this could lead to a significant reduction in the data load on the node and thus increase interoperability within the network.
